NC-based Marine battalion deploys for Iraq

CAMP LEJEUNE — A North Carolina-based Marine battalion has deployed for Iraq’s Anbar province after training for the mission for nearly a year.

The Daily News of Jacksonville reported the 1st Battalion, 2nd Marine Regiment shipped out of Camp Lejeune over the weekend for a seven-month deployment. The unit is a member of the 2nd Marine Division, which is based at Camp Lejeune.

A base spokesman said Monday the battalion has roughly 1,000 members.

The battalion commander, Lt. Col. Timothy Winand, said his troops have been training since October and “we’re ready to go.”
